This portrait print showcases the esteemed Alexandre Balthazar Laurent Grimod de la Reyniere, a prominent figure in French history. Painted by the talented artist Louis-Leopold Boilly, this neoclassical masterpiece captures the essence of de la Reyniere's distinguished character and refined taste. Displayed at the Musee Marmottan Monet in Paris, this oil on canvas artwork exudes elegance and sophistication. The intricate details and skillful brushstrokes bring to life every aspect of de la Reyniere's visage, from his piercing gaze to his meticulously groomed appearance. As one of France's most influential gastronomes and writers during the late 18th and early 19th centuries, de la Reyniere revolutionized culinary arts with his innovative ideas and writings. This portrait immortalizes him as a visionary who paved the way for modern gastronomy.
